Poplar Point
It turns out according to my sources that Councilman Kwame Brown didn't know that his name was on the press release announcing that he and Ward Eight Councilman Marion Barry would be holding a joint press conference to announce their disgust with Mayor Fenty's pulling the Poplar Point development deal from Victor MacFarlane and DC United. Brown saw the press release and his name not long before the Press Conference and decided not to attend. Barry went forward Wednesday afternoon accompanied by some well known activists who support the MacFarlane plan. The former four term Mayor charged Fenty with backing out of the deal after having given Barry the go ahead to make it happen. I've put in a request for the Mayor to respond.
